The search for "Evolution Barton Briggs Pdf Freel" refers to the seminal textbook , co-authored by Nicholas H. Barton Derek E. G. Briggs Jonathan A. Eisen David B. Goldstein Nipam H. Patel

. First published in 2007, it remains a cornerstone for graduate students and researchers due to its multidisciplinary approach, bridging classical genetics with modern molecular biology and paleontology.

Understanding Evolution by Barton, Briggs, et al. The search term "Evolution Barton Briggs Pdf" typically refers to the seminal textbook Evolution, co-authored by Nicholas H. Barton, Derek E. G. Briggs, and several other leading scientists. Published by Cold Spring Harbor Laboratory Press, this work is widely regarded as one of the most comprehensive and modern resources in the field of evolutionary biology. Core Themes and Content

Unlike many traditional textbooks, Evolution focuses heavily on the integration of molecular biology and genomics with classical evolutionary theory. The book is structured into four main parts:

Part I: An Overview of Evolutionary Biology – Covers the history of the field, the origin of molecular biology, and the evidence supporting evolutionary theory.

Part II: The Origin and Diversification of Life – Explores the history of life on Earth, from the origin of life to the evolution of multicellularity and developmental programs.

Part III: Evolutionary Processes – Delves into the mechanisms that drive change, such as mutation, natural selection, random drift, and social evolution.

Part IV: Human Evolution – Provides an up-to-date summary of human origins, including the "Out-of-Africa" hypothesis and the genomics of humanness. Why It Stands Out Evolution Home Page
